| | Kunsthalle Nürnberg: Niki de Saint Phalle |
 | | Niki de Saint Phalle (1930 - 2002) is one of Europe's most fascinating artists. |
 | | Shortly after her marriage to Harry Mathews, Niki de Saint Phalle gave birth to a daughter, moved to Paris in 1952, travelled extensively, took acting lessons, gave birth to a son, suffered a nervous breakdown, and from 1956, worked intensively as an artist, concentrating particularly on assemblages. |
 | | With her shooting paintings (Tirs) and performances, Niki de Saint Phalle struck the nerve of the age in 1961, providing an important impetus for the 'Nouveaux Réalistes' movement, and embodied a new image of woman at an early stage. |
